MBZ 2002- C 320
Attention to detail is excellent as is the layout and comfort features. Finish and fit is flawless. Bose sound system is without peer and the CD player works well. Layout of controls a little different and take getting used to,but once you are used to their placement they are convenient and make a lot of sense. Car is consistant with MB reputation and quality.
I love my wife's car.
I warm up to cars slowly but this latest C-Class by MB with the big 3.2L twin-spark V6 won me over quickly. And, it's big enough for 95 percentile males to drive and has many comfortable seating positions. The engine just loafs, even on the biggest hills, and the whole package delivers comforting feelings of security, competence and value.
